vertical align div position absolute
I am trying to find the most effective way to align text with a div. I have tried a few things and none seem to work. .testimonialText . position: absolute left: 15px top: 15px width: 150px height: 309px vertical- align: middle text-align: center font-family: Georgia, "Times New Roman", Times, serif align contents to bottom of div without using position:absolute.Okay Ive read the questions on here regarding vertical align with absolute positioning. However, none of them solves my problem. Usually I vertically center a button, inside an absolute positioned div with top:50, and margin-left:-(height/2), but today I realised its not perfect, or I dont know how to use it correctly.Changing the vertical alignment of the div to be vertical-align: top will fix this. A demo of vertical aligning text in a div without vertical-align property. In this demo, the text is vertically aligned inside a div element. Tags: css vertical-alignment absolute.adjust container width by absolutely positioned inner element or vertical align bottom. Center and Right div Positioning. how to center div vertically inside of absolutely positioned parent div. Vertically align center for a ion-card [IONIC]. getClientRects() method doesnt work with absolute positioned elements in IE 11.See here for reference. Changing the vertical alignment of the div to be vertical-align: top will fix this. The text-align property only works on inline elements.
This doesnt work if the outer div has a fixed height. Centering a div at the bottom of a page. This uses margin auto and an absolute-positioned outer div. Vertical align reusable class. darenm/dabblet.css( css).container > div display: table-cell vertical-align: middle position: static The CSS vertical align property works smoothly with tables, but not with divs or any other elements. When you use it in a div, it aligns the element alongsideThe element is rendered following the order of the HTML.
position: absolute — used to define the exact position the element needs to be in. Browse other questions tagged html css vertical-alignment absolute or ask your own question. asked.How to center absolutely positioned element in div? 775. How do I vertically align text in a div? We can then use vertical-align on the child div and set its value to middle.Absolute Positioning and Negative Margin. This method works for block level elements and also works in all browsers. The vertical align property is used to align elements vertically. Note that when applied it will align only in-line elements or inline-block elements.For example, a div is a block element. If you try vertical align in Div, it wont work. Where the .container div is absolutely positioned as half of its parent.You can then use vertical-align: .out width:100 height:500px background-color:blue position:relative.content position: absolute or relative top: 50 transform: translateY(-50) .table-cell-wrapper position: absolute .table-cell height: 200px width: 200px vertical-align: middle background: eee display: table-cellDiv Size Automatically size of content. Scanf in multiple goroutines giving unexpected results. Vertical alignment of elements in a div. How to horizontally center a < div> in another
? How to align checkboxes and their labels consistently cross-browsers.Simple, I use z-index and give them position:absolute. div line-height:8em img vertical-align:middle Notice that vertical- align is only used for image.IE5.5 IE6 Opera 6. Text centering works. Using absolute positioning. How can I vertically center align divs using absolute position? The div should have margin-bottom if there are multiple divs found in single column. .parent position: relative background: FF0000 width: 100 height: 100px padding:20px 0px . .childrenmultipleincolumn position: absolute Why not? Position: absolute forces display: block, read number two here. As for a workaround, I think youll have to wrap it in another element: < div class"table-cell-wrapper">
<. I heard its due to absolute positioning and tried this solution with no luck: CSS - Vertical align table-cell dont work with position absolute.Does anyone know a way of getting the green div.middle elements to vertically align to the middle? I am trying to get blue container in the middle of pink one, however seems vertical-align: middle doesnt do the job in that case.
, one is the container, theThe last method to vertical centering is by using Flexbox. Flexbox is a new module in CSS3. It offers a more straightforward method for aligning content. CSS Horizontal Align of Block Elements. The block element is an element that uses up the full width that is available. It also has a line break located before and after each element.Here is an example of a code that uses absolute positioning I heard its due to absolute positioning and tried this solution with no luck: CSS - Vertical align table-cell dont work with position absolute.Does anyone know a way of getting the green div.middle elements to vertically align to the middle? When the novice developer applies vertical-align to normal block elements (like a standard < div>) most browsers set the value to inherit to all inline children of that element.Specify the parent container as position:relative or position:absolute. .centerMe margin: auto position: absolute top: 0 left: 0 bottom: 0 right: 0 Now, if you want to move a div a little bit down, just change.Whay cant u just use: .className vertical-align: middle Andrey.
.In this example you can set vertical align middle using position:absolute and position:relative property of css. containingBlock height: 200px position: relative overflow: hidden containingBlock div position: absolute top: 50 containingBlock div p position: relative top: -50Horizontal Vertical Alignment For Div Tag Using CSS. How to use vertical-align in CSS. Left and Right Align - Using position. One method for aligning elements is to use position: absolute: In my younger and more vulnerable years my father gave me some advice that Ive been turning over in my mind ever since. vertical-align:middle. there is a different approach: for the element within your DIV, set display:absolute and bottom:0px (or top:0px) to vertically align to bottom or top, respectively.Container DIV should be set to position:relative. Margin and padding dont seem to work with position:absolute, and left/right/top/bottom dont take "auto" as value.You may put a single celled table in the AP div, like so.
table height: 100 width: 100 td vertical-align: middle Especially, that the height of the centered element(s) can be flexible sets this method apart from all other methods relying on absolute positioning with negative margins or margin: auto. This makes the vertical-align method the most maintainable. Responsively setting vertical-alignment on divs with CSS. Beware, things get all crazy one you start nesting these divs.div class"vertical-align vertical-align--middle">vertical-align-wrap position: absolute width: 100 height: 100 display: table divcss, divcss, divcss, divcss, divcss. Alexa Rank: 555,966 Google PR: 4 of 10 Daily Visits: 855 Website Value: 6,156 USD.Video by Topic - Vertical Align Text Div Position Absolute.